2004 Fee Schedule Correction Memo

DATE:    February 20, 2004

 

TO:        All Interested Parties

 

FROM:   Health Care Services Division

 

RE:        Fee Schedule Correction Memo

 

It has been brought to our attention that the fee schedule tables for the medicine services and laboratory & pathology services had rounding errors. Due to the rounding errors, the maximum allowable payments listed in those 2 tables did not equal the RVU x the conversion factor of $47.77.

 

Both the Fee Schedule tables for the medicine services and the laboratory & pathology services have now been corrected and posted on the website so that that maximum allowable payment or the MAP will equal the RVU times the conversion factor of $47.77.  You can either download the corrected tables, or you can calculate the maximum allowable payments by multiplying the listed RVU by the conversion factor of $47.77.

 

Additionally, since the relative values for all of the fee tables were based upon 2003 relative value information, the fee schedules do not contain fees for the codes added in 2004, therefore a separate fee table is provided listing only the CPT® procedures added in 2004. The fees for the newly added codes only are based upon 2004 RVU data times the $47.77 conversion factor.
